Novices Guide to Metal Polishing - Mostly, the polishing of metal is essential for appearance as well as clean-room usages. It is one of the more preferred practices for its use in enhancing the original beauty of the items, such as, motorbike parts, cookware or automobile parts. Additionally, lots of clean-rooms would need a burnished finish in an effort to reduce the permeability of the material which can cause particles to gather and contaminate. A great demonstration of this use could be in a vacuum chamber.

You'll find a great number of methods of polish metal, and we will look at examples of the procedures involved. Metal may be finished electromechanically, using chemicals, manually, or with purpose made buffing machines. A finishing compound or paste is frequently utilised, that might incorporate aluminum oxide, limestone, chromium oxide, tripoli, chalk, dolomite, or iron oxide.

Finishing stainless steel, because of its weak thermal conductivity, its hardness, and its reasonably high viscidity is typically one of the most time-consuming. Conversely, merchandise manufactured from non-ferrous metal tend to be more amenable to polishing, mainly because these need the minimum amount of treatments.

A reduced pad speed is required any time a premium quality mirror finish is expected. Finishing buffs coated in compound can be dramatically affected by specific forces on the polishing pad. The level of the pressure on the surface can be elevated to a definite range, however further surpassing the perfect amount of pressure not only minimizes the quality level of the procedure, but also can worsen performance, can bring about wear on the part, and there's also an apparent heating up of the work-pieces, as a result of friction. When working thin material, it is greater heat (and the relating flexibility of the metal) that causes materials to twist, buckle or distort. By and large, it takes an experienced polisher to consider all of these fundamentals to both prevent harm to the workpiece and to perform competently. In order to significantly increase the standard of the resultant surface area, the finishing procedure must be completed with a reduced amount of vigour and not so much force in order to subsequently deliver a surface that is free of scratches or marks coming from the buffing process, thus ending up with a lovely mirror finish.
